VIDEO – Winner of the Best Toyo Tires SEMA Truck/SUV Build Award at the 2018 SEMA Show

Carolina Kustoms and Church Built Customs in Portland, OR teamed up for Chris Church’s amazing build.  His heavily modified 1940 Ford pickup sits on top a full custom Schroeder Speed chassis while there is extensive use of carbon fiber and aluminum throughout the build.  Power is supplied by a Wegner Motorsports Chevrolet LS3 engine topped by a Whipple supercharger to make over 900-hp.  To harness that power, a QA1 carbon fiber driveline forms the link to the rear axle.  The truck rides on custom-built wheels from American Racing with 19-inch front and 20-inch rear Toyo Proxes R888R tires.

 

Judging took place on-site at the 2018 SEMA Show for vehicles displayed throughout the Las Vegas Convention Center. Entries were judged on several factors including modifications, overall execution and embodiment of the Toyo Tires brand and lifestyle image.  The awards announcements were made in the Toyo Tires Treadpass exhibit.
